This week on Street Beat, Syma Chowdhry takes a look at the environment and the organizations trying to keep it healthy.
Up first Tom Quail from the Clinton River Watershed Council stops by to talk about the watershed and the CRWC's upcoming event, "Walk on the Wild Side." www.crwc.org
Then Colleen Robar -- Board of Commissioner and Chair of the Marketing Committee for The Greening of Detroit explains how they are changing the face of Detroit…one tree at a time. www.greeningofdetroit.org
Next Taja Sevelle explains why Urban Farming is so important to Detroit. www.urbanfarming.org
Finally, Syma learns about the premiere outdoor art fair in Michigan, the Ann Arbor Art Fair, from Maureen Riley, Executive Director of the Ann Arbor Street Art Fair and featured artist Julie Fremuth. theannarborartfair.com
